Neo-Witch Hunters

by Annalegra

[WVox Sponsor]

Age Group: Adult



And so they yell out
“Burn the books”,
As once they shouted
“Burn the witch”.
And still they are
Convinced that fire
Will rid them of
That Pagan itch.

Do it our way
praise our God,
They scream aloud
in full furor,
They do not
want to listen
to any of
our Pagan lore.

They never try
to understand
The natural things
we like to do,
Our reverence of
Nature and
our love of
all life too.

They think there’s
only one road,
to walk ones way
through life.
They cannot see
the other paths
that in our
world are rife.

But don’t be
angry with them,
For they don’t have
eyes that see.
They have deaf ears
That only hear
The things they
Want to be.

They’ll never know
the liberties
which we Pagans
know so well,
They are just like
Pavlovs dogs
when they hear their
Sunday bell.

They are ignorant
of freedom
to converse alone
with Deity.
they do not understand us
when we
say that we are free.

They say we love
their devil,
They say we
must be bad,
They say that we must
all be saved
and for that we must be glad!

So when we hear
them yelling for
another thing
they want to burn,
we must stay strong,
with heads held high,
and their caustic
taunting spurn.

And so we live our
Pagan lives,
Alongside the ones
Who cannot see.
We’ll not be quelled
this time around,
we’re here to stay,
So Blessed Be!

Copyright 2003 Annalegra
